Cross-Layer Communication

Architecture

Cross-Layer Communication within decentralized systems represents the interoperability enabling data and value transfer between distinct blockchain layers, typically Layer-1 and Layer-2 solutions, or between different Layer-2 protocols. This facilitates a more fluid ecosystem, addressing scalability limitations inherent in single-layer architectures and unlocking complex financial instruments. Effective implementation requires standardized protocols and secure bridging mechanisms to maintain data integrity and prevent fragmentation of liquidity across these interconnected networks. Consequently, it’s crucial for optimizing capital efficiency and enabling sophisticated derivative strategies.
